Egypt Supports Belgium's Settlement Goods Ban

Egypt welcomed the Belgian government's decision to ban the import of goods and products from Israeli settlements in the occupied Palestinian territories, including East Jerusalem, considering it a step in support of the values of justice and United Nations resolutions, especially Security Council Resolution 2334, which affirms the illegality of settlement activity and calls for its immediate halt. Egypt called on the European Union countries and the international community to take similar measures to stop products from settlements, emphasizing that peace in the Middle East requires ending the occupation, enabling Palestinians to realize their legitimate rights, and establishing their independent state on the 1967 borders with East Jerusalem as its capital. This came after the Belgian government, before the summer holiday, decided to prohibit the import of settlement products through an official amendment that sets strict rules to prevent the entry of any goods indicated in documents as originating from Israeli settlements, within a licensing system that automatically rejects any import requests for such products, with a transitional period of 120 days for compliance. These measures are part of an escalation by the Israeli occupation in the West Bank and Gaza Strip, amid ongoing assaults and invasions. The number of Palestinian martyrs and casualties has exceeded 73,000 since the start of the aggression two years ago, amid a severe deterioration in humanitarian and health conditions in the Gaza Strip.
